Oliver Zhang is a Senior Product Manager with 11+ years building digital media and education products for Chinese audiences, currently leading FTChinese’s product team across web and mobile platforms. He combines product leadership with hands-on HTML5 development—having personally built some of FTChinese’s best-regarded apps and shipping the Apple-recommended "MBA GYM" in 2012. Previously he scaled Chinese.WSJ.com’s audience tenfold as Product Manager at The Wall Street Journal and has deep experience bridging editorial and technical teams from his Dow Jones tenure. Based in Beijing, he’s fluent at turning design, development and QA into rapid, polished product releases and often fills the gap between strategy and implementation.
